What to Look for Before Buying the Best Pots For Gas Range
Find Your Need - Compatibility and use case considerations
The first step is determining whether you are outfitting a home kitchen or a commercial establishment. Gas ranges vary wildly in their power output. If you are using a standard residential stove, accessories like ring reducers are essential for small pots. If you are a professional, you need a dedicated stock pot range that can handle 80,000 BTUs or more. Always check if your gas line provides natural gas or liquid propane, as most high-power equipment is fuel-specific.
Budget - Setting realistic price expectations ($15-$800 ranges)
Prices for gas range gear span a wide spectrum. Simple cast iron reducers and accessories typically range from $15 to $40. Moving up to specialized glassware like borosilicate kettles will cost between $40 and $80. For commercial-grade stock pot ranges and burners, expect to invest anywhere from $200 for single burners to over $800 for high-capacity multi-burner units with cabinets.
Key Features - Most important technical specifications
Look for BTU (British Thermal Unit) ratings to understand how much heat the burner produces. For stock pots, 80,000 BTUs is the standard for fast boiling. Another key feature is flame control—dual-zone controls allow you to light only the inner ring for small pots or both rings for large ones. Certification, such as CSA or ETL, is also vital for safety and insurance compliance in professional settings.
Quality & Durability - What to look for in construction
Gas flames are incredibly hard on materials. Stainless steel (specifically 430 grade) and cast iron are the gold standards. Stainless steel offers rust resistance and ease of cleaning, while cast iron provides unmatched heat retention and durability. Avoid thin metals that can warp or melt under the intense heat of a high-BTU burner.

Portability/Size - Considerations for space and storage
Measure your available counter or floor space before buying a range. Countertop models are great for saving floor space, but they must be placed on a non-combustible surface. If you have a mobile kitchen, look for compact single-burner units or those with integrated cabinets to keep your workspace organized and efficient.

What features are most important in pots for gas range? Thermal conductivity and stability are the most important. On the burner side, look for high BTU ratings (80,000+) and dual-zone flame control. For the pots themselves, look for thick, heavy bottoms that distribute heat evenly, as the concentrated flame of a gas burner can otherwise create hot spots and burn your food.
How do I maintain my pots for gas range? Clean the burners regularly to prevent grease buildup, which can clog the gas ports and cause an uneven flame. For stainless steel pots, use a specialized cleaner to remove heat tint. For cast iron components, ensure they are dried thoroughly after washing to prevent rust, and occasionally re-season them with a light coating of oil.
